不能简单地说哪种方法更好,因为它们都是用于不同的目的。mlock主要用于锁定内存以防止被交换到交换空间,以提高性能和安全性。
EMOD则用于检测运行时的错误和异常,以帮助开发人员快速找到并修复代码中的问题。在应用程序中,这两种方法可以结合使用以获得更好的结果。如果应用程序需要高性能且需要处理大量数据,mlock是一个很好的选择。如果应用程序需要更多的调试和错误检测,那么EMOD就更适合一些。因此,选择哪种方法应该取决于应用程序的需要和要求。